Purchasing a property is a significant investment and a decision that can have long-term financial consequences. While it may be tempting to try to save money by not hiring a real estate agent, it is important to consider all the potential risks and drawbacks of going it alone. Here are a few reasons why it may be wrong to try to buy a property without the help of a real estate agent.
- Lack of market knowledge and expertise: Real estate agents have a wealth of knowledge and expertise when it comes to the local property market. They are familiar with current market trends, property values, and the legalities involved in buying and selling real estate. Without their expertise, you may not have a clear understanding of what you are getting for your money or the potential risks associated with a particular property.
- Limited access to listings: Real estate agents have access to a wide range of listings that may not be readily available to the general public. This means that you may miss out on some of the best properties on the market if you are not working with an agent. In addition, agents often have connections within the industry and may be able to help you secure a property that is not yet listed on the market.
- Negotiation skills: Negotiating the price of a property can be a complex and stressful process. Real estate agents are experienced in this area and can help you get the best deal possible. Without their assistance, you may end up paying more than you should or agreeing to terms that are not in your best interests.
- Legal considerations: Buying a property involves a lot of legal paperwork and processes, including contracts, disclosures, and inspections. Real estate agents are trained to navigate these complex legal issues and can help ensure that everything is in order before you close the deal. Without their assistance, you may not fully understand your rights and responsibilities as a buyer, which could lead to costly mistakes or legal disputes down the road.
- Stress and time: Buying a property is a time-consuming and often stressful process. Real estate agents can help alleviate some of this stress by handling many of the details and coordinating with other parties involved in the transaction. Without their assistance, you may be left to handle everything on your own, which can be overwhelming and take up a significant amount of your time.
